What is High-Quality Steel Matting?
High-quality steel matting, often referred to as steel mesh or steel grating, is a series of interconnected steel bars or rods, typically arranged in a grid-like format. The quality of steel used, along with its treatment and manufacturing process, significantly determines the matting's durability, strength, and resistance to corrosion and wear. High-quality steel matting can be either hot-rolled or cold-rolled, with hot-rolled meshes often providing enhanced strength due to the forging process.
Applications of Steel Matting
Steel matting is utilized across various sectors, including construction, infrastructure, and even agricultural industries. Its applications include
1. Flooring In commercial and industrial settings, steel matting is commonly used as flooring in warehouses, factories, and even pedestrian walkways. Its slip-resistant properties and durability make it an ideal choice for high-traffic areas where safety is paramount.
2. Reinforcement When integrated into concrete structures, high-quality steel matting provides vital reinforcement. This application enhances the tensile strength of concrete, allowing it to withstand greater loads and resist cracking over time.
3. Docks and Platforms Steel matting is frequently used in the construction of docks, platforms, and scaffolding. The ability of steel to withstand harsh environments, including exposure to water and chemicals, makes it a reliable choice for these applications.
4. Fencing and Security In security applications, high-quality steel matting serves as fencing material that provides both visibility and robust protection. It is often used in prisons, industrial sites, and commercial properties to deter unauthorized access.
Benefits of Using High-Quality Steel Matting
Choosing high-quality steel matting offers numerous advantages
1. Strength and Durability One of the most significant benefits of high-quality steel matting is its strength. It is engineered to withstand extreme conditions, including heavy loads, impacts, and environmental exposures.
2. Safety Features Steel matting often comes with slip-resistant surfaces, reducing the risk of accidents in industrial and construction environments. This feature is crucial in maintaining safety standards in workplaces with heavy foot and vehicle traffic.
3. Cost-Effectiveness While the initial investment in high-quality steel matting may be higher than lower quality alternatives, its durability and low maintenance needs make it a cost-effective choice in the long run.
4. Versatility High-quality steel matting can be customized to meet specific requirements, including varying load capacities and environmental conditions. This versatility makes it suitable for many applications across different industries.
5. Sustainability Steel is a recyclable material, and using high-quality steel matting contributes to sustainability efforts in construction. Choosing steel products reduces the reliance on non-renewable resources and minimizes overall waste.
